Functional Status

Functional status values are used to provide information about the operational condition of a space or subSpace, for example, In Use, or Under Renovation. The values you define populate the Functional Status drop-down menu on the Categorization pane of the View Space, Edit Space, View SubSpace and Edit SubSpace pages..

To open the Functional Status page:

  1. Open the Administration Menu page.

  2. Under the SPACE ADMIN heading, click Functional Status.

    The Admin – Functional Status page opens. All defined functional status values are displayed, listed in order of Tab Order first, then chronologically by Last Update date.

ClosedCreate a Functional Status

Creating a functional status allows you to define values that specify the operational condition of a space or subSpace. To create a functional status value:

  1. Click the Add New link.

    The Add Functional Status dialog box opens, allowing you to define the new value.

  2. In the Name field, enter the functional status value name.

  3. In the Description field, enter a description of the functional status value.

    This field can be used to provide more information about the functional status value. This value can be up to 1000 characters long. As you type, the character count updates indicating the number of additional characters that can be entered.

  4. In the Tab Order field, enter a numeric value.

    The Tab Order indicates the position, in menus, where this value will be listed. Lower numbered values are displayed toward the top of the list. Values will the same tab order will be sorted alphabetically.

  5. In the Active field, select Yes to make this functional status value active.

    Inactive values remain in the system, but are not displayed to users.

  6. Click OK.

    The functional status value is added to the list. The name of the user who added the functional status value and the date and time it was added are displayed.

ClosedEdit a Functional Status

Functional status values can be modified. For example, if you want to change the value that users see, you can modify the name. To edit a functional status value:

  1. Click the Edit link to the right of the functional status value you want to edit.

  2. Modify any of the following values:

    • Name – the value that users see
    • Description – information about the functional status value
    • Tab Order – the position in which the functional status value will be displayed in drop-down menus
    • Active – Yes indicates that the functional status value is active (displayed to the user)
  3. Click OK.

    The modified functional status parameters, including the name of the user who edited them and the date and time when they were edited, are displayed.

ClosedDelete a Functional Status

Functional status values that have not been used can be deleted from the system.

If a functional status value has been used but is no longer needed, you can edit it and make it inactive to prevent it from being displayed to users.

To delete a functional status value:

  1. Click the Delete link to the right of the functional status value you want to delete.

    A dialog box opens asking you to confirm your choice.

  2. Click OK.
